FAQs on White Console Tables

How do I choose the right white console table for my hallway?

Measure your space first—most hallways suit tables 80–120cm wide and 30–40cm deep. Consider storage needs: drawers for keys and post, shelves for display. Check weight capacity if displaying heavier items. Match your décor style: modern, traditional, or industrial finishes available.

Common options include solid wood (oak, pine), engineered wood, MDF, and glass. Solid wood is durable but pricier; MDF is budget-friendly but less sturdy. Glass tops offer modern style but require regular cleaning. Choose based on your budget, durability needs, and décor preference.

Most console tables support 20–30kg safely. Solid wood tables typically handle 30kg; MDF and glass-top models around 20kg. Distribute weight evenly and avoid concentrating heavy items in one spot. Check the product spec sheet for exact weight capacity before purchasing.

Layer a mirror or artwork above it for impact. Add a table lamp, small plant, or decorative tray. Keep styling minimal in small spaces—three to five items work best. Use a runner rug beneath to ground the space. Swap seasonal décor to refresh the look regularly.

Dust weekly with a soft cloth to prevent dirt build-up on white finishes. Clean spills immediately with a damp microfibre cloth and mild soap solution. Avoid abrasive cleaners, bleach, and excess water. Polish quarterly with furniture wax for wood tables to maintain appearance.
